Description:

One double-ended, double container powder horn. The piece is formed from two horns fused together with screws and covered with a band of horn with nozzles at each end plugged with wooden stoppers. One horn is acorn shaped while the other is carved in a crossed pattern. Leather strands, attached at the collars of each end, are threaded through the stoppers to prevent them from being dropped. A length of cord is tied from collar to collar for carrying.
